Understanding Full Truck Load Services in Modern Logistics
Full Truck Load Services refer to a freight movement system where a truck is booked exclusively for a single shipper’s cargo. This means the goods are loaded once at the pickup point and are not touched again until they reach the final destination. The direct nature of the journey reduces time, eliminates unnecessary handling, and ensures that the shipment remains secure throughout the route. Unlike less-than-truckload shipping, where goods from multiple clients are consolidated, full truckload transportation is clean, direct, and transparent. The entire capacity of the truck is dedicated to one shipment, which helps businesses move larger quantities of goods with far greater control.
Businesses benefit from the simplicity and efficiency of FTL because they can decide the route, delivery time, and loading schedule according to their specific needs. This type of freedom is extremely valuable for companies that deal with bulky shipments or time-sensitive material. Full Truck Load Services help them maintain a structured logistics flow that supports continuous production and uninterrupted supply chain activity.

The Business Advantages of Choosing Full Truck Load Services
Full Truck Load Services offer multiple business benefits, starting with faster transit. Since there is no involvement of other shippers, trucks travel directly along the planned route, which reduces delivery time significantly. This speed becomes a major performance driver for businesses operating across multiple states or managing high distribution demand.
Another major advantage is the reduced risk of damage. Goods remain inside the same truck from start to finish, eliminating risks associated with multiple handling or loading points. This is especially valuable for fragile, delicate, or premium goods. The cost-efficiency of FTL also improves with shipment volume, making it an economical option for businesses that frequently move large quantities of cargo. The greater control over route planning allows companies to optimize transportation schedules and improve the reliability of their supply chain.
